X572 CNN is a 2000 Citroen Dispatch in White with a 1,868c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 2000 Citroen Dispatch models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.5% with a typical mileage of 111,500 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en Dispatch f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,685 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X572 CNN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Dispatch typ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 26 years old, this Citroen Dispatch is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
